My chickens seem to like to pick through the new pine bedding after it's put down. Apparenlty eating some of it. Should this be concerning? It 's the kind you get at any local feed store. Not much information on the bag label.

They have plenty of fresh feed nearby, so it's not due to hunger. Thanks for the input and experience.
 
My girls do the same thing.
I think they are just making sure no food is in that new stuff & rearranging it to their liking.
Eating a few pine shavings shouldn't be a problem.
 
Mine will do the same thing, too. They also love eating the fresh hay that I put down along with the pine shavings.

As long as they don't eat too much of it (which could cause impacted crop...but again, only if they eat A LOT of it), it shouldn't hurt them.
